Summary of Responsibilities:
Review, research and investigate new and ongoing Total and Permanent and Premium Waiver claims to determine if claim is payable in accordance with policy provisions. Initiate investigations to obtain medical and vocational evidence required for approval of claim. Provide customer service with empathy and patience on incoming and outgoing phone inquiries. _____________________________________________________________________
Principal Responsibilities:
1. Evaluate new and ongoing Total & Permanent (T&P) and Premium Waiver (PW) claims to determine MetLife's liability.
2. Interpret policy provisions to determine eligibility and make claim determinations.
3. Initiate investigations through both company and external contacts (i.e., employees, employers and physicians) to obtain medical and vocational evidence required for approval of claim.
4. Establish action plans for each file to bring claim to resolution within specified timeframes.
5. Evaluate claims to identify situations requiring referral to Senior Examiner.
6. Respond to written and/or telephone inquiries from policyholders, employers and physicians to resolve claim issues swiftly and thoroughly.
7. Maintain production and quality standards.
8. Utilize internal specialty resources to maximize impact on each file.
9. Manage and organize work to meet multiple deadlines and competing priorities to ensure department turnaround and customer satisfaction are met.
10. Understand and use PC programs to increase productivity and performance.
11. Utilize internal specialty resources to maximize impact on each file.
12. Keep up to date on Premium Waiver procedures and attending required training.
Knowledge/Skills/Competencies Required:
• Excellent oral and written communication skills
• Customer service experience in a professional work environment
• Analytical ability and good judgment in evaluating claims
• Strong Data entry skills and PC knowledge (Microsoft Word and Excel)
• Ability to adjust and respond positively to multiple demands and shifting priorities
• Understands the sense of urgency in claims management and business demands; knows when to act quickly and when to give decision more time and thought
• Ability to plan and organize time and priorities to achieve business results
• Works collaboratively with others, shares best practices and assists teammates with work
• Ability to work periodic overtime
Knowledge/Skills/Competencies Preferred:
• Life and/or Disability insurance experience
• Knowledge of medical terminology
• College degree or relevant work experience desirable
The expected salary range for this position is $45,000 - $52,000. This role may also be eligible for annual short-term incentive compensation. All incentives and benefits are subject to the applicable plan terms.
